Presque Isle man arrested after fleeing scene of accident

    MERRILL — A Presque Isle man was charged Thanksgiving evening with numerous motor vehicle citations and criminal mischief after leading police on a brief chase.
    Wayne Boulier, Jr., 32, was driving a 2011 Nissan sedan on Route 212 in Merrill when he lost control, going off the road and striking some trees, before fleeing the scene on foot, according to Maine State Police.
    Troopers Carman Lilley and Jill Monahan responded to the crash and began searching for the driver. Trooper Chad Fuller was dispatched with his tracking dog, Glenni, and Boulier was found a short time later coming out of a wooded area.
    Boulier was arrested for operating after suspension, violation of conditions of release, driving to endanger and criminal mischief.  He was transported to Houlton Regional Hospital for treatment of minor injuries from the crash and then brought to the Aroostook County Jail. The car sustained significant damage in the crash and was towed from the scene.
